Rapid deployment, zero infrastructure.

Every trailer is self-contained. Solar-powered, cellular-connected, and towable. No electrical hookup, no Wi-Fi dependency, no permits in most jurisdictions. Tow it into position, raise the mast, and you have 8 cameras at 4K resolution covering your venue within an hour.

How far in advance do I need to book?

Ideally 1-2 weeks for single-unit deployments. Larger events or multi-trailer setups benefit from more lead time so we can plan coverage zones properly. That said, we’ve deployed within 48 hours for urgent situations.
